World War II Honoree

Killed in World War II

Joseph H. Coale

Branch of Service

U.S. Army

Hometown

New Cumberland, Pennsylvania

Honored By

A Grateful American

Branch Seal
Activity During WWII

He served as a Sergeant in WWII with the 100th Infantry Division (Century Division), 398th Infantry Regiment, Second Battalion, Company G, in the European Theater of Operations. Killed in Action on March 1, 1945, he was awarded the Purple Heart.
